Exactly How Roof Air Flow Functions



Efficient roofing system ventilation relies upon the natural movement of air to develop a balance between intake and exhaust. When you set up vents, you're essentially permitting fresh air to enter your attic while enabling hot, stagnant air to leave. This process assists regulate temperature level and wetness levels, protecting against issues like mold growth and roofing system damage.

Consumption vents, commonly located at the eaves, reel in amazing air from outside. On the other hand, exhaust vents, located near the ridge of the roof, let hot air surge and exit. The distinction in temperature develops an all-natural air flow, called the stack effect. As siding contractor surges, it develops a vacuum cleaner that pulls in cooler air from the reduced vents.

To optimize this system, you need to make certain that the intake and exhaust vents are properly sized and positioned. If the intake is restricted, you won't attain the wanted air flow.

Also, inadequate exhaust can catch warmth and dampness, resulting in prospective damages.

Trick Setup Factors To Consider



When mounting roofing air flow, several essential factors to consider can make or damage your system's performance. First, you require to evaluate your roof covering's style. The pitch, shape, and products all affect airflow and air flow option. Make sure to pick vents that suit your roof kind and regional environment conditions.

Next, consider the placement of your vents. Preferably, you'll desire a well balanced system with consumption and exhaust vents placed for ideal airflow. Place consumption vents low on the roof covering and exhaust vents near the top to motivate a natural circulation of air. This arrangement assists avoid moisture build-up and promotes energy performance.


Don't forget about insulation. Appropriate insulation in your attic avoids heat from getting away and maintains your home comfy. Ensure that insulation doesn't obstruct your vents, as this can impede air flow.

Last but not least, consider maintenance. Pick ventilation systems that are very easy to accessibility for cleaning and assessment. Routine upkeep guarantees your system continues to operate properly in time.
